Summit League Tournament - Recap - South Dakota State Defeats IUPU Fort Wayne 85-75

Nate Wolters poured in 30 points for South Dakota State on Sunday, as they defeated IUPU Fort Wayne 85-75 at Sioux Falls Arena.

Bettors who backed South Dakota State were also rewarded, as they covered the closing number as a favorite of 5 at sportsbooks.

Dale Moss had 21 points for South Dakota State and Clint Sargent chipped in with 14 points. Nate Wolters had 5 assists for them, while Dale Moss was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 9 boards.

IUPU Fort Wayne got a 21-point performance from Frank Gaines, who was supported by 16 points from Ben Botts. Zach Plackemeier had 7 assists in a losing cause for IUPU Fort Wayne, while Frank Gaines grabbed 12 rebounds.

First-half bettors who backed South Dakota State were victorious, as the score was 43-29 at the break.

South Dakota State won the battle of the boards, outrebounding their counterparts 41-34.
